dnf install/remove/search/update 安装/删除/搜索/更新就不说了,基本操作。
dnf info emacs 查询某软件详细信息。常用的命令!
dnf list installed 列出已装软件。常用的命令!
一般在后面加上 | grep chrome 显示自己想找的软件。
dnf makecache 更新软件源缓存。不常用。
这个命令其实不怎么需要自己手动输入,因为在用 update 或 install 时,系统会智能判断是否需要刷新缓存。了解一下。
dnf clean all 删除所有软件缓存。不常用。
有时候更新出问题或者换一条软件源,可以把缓存清理一下,重新下载。
dnf repolist 列出软件源。
dnf repolist all 列出软件源(详细版)。
dnf config-manager --set-disable sublime-text 禁用某个软件源。
有些软件源不想用了,可以在 /etc/yum.repo.d/ 目录删掉那个文件。也可以使用以上命令禁用,也许以后还用的着呢? --set-enable 选项重新启用。
dnf history dnf的历史记录。
你用 dnf 做了那些操作?这里都有记录。
dnf history userinstalled 用户安装的历史记录。
你用 dnf install 安装了哪些软件?这里有记录哦。
dnf provides这个命令可以查看我的dnf库里是否有某软件源
dnf builddep emacs
安装 emacs 的依赖,但是不安装 emacs。好处是可以用来编译 emacs 的源码,不用处理 emacs 的依赖